Quite possibly the most popular variety of samurai sword may be the katana, which turned the standard weapon in the samurai course. Together with it, warriors also carried shorter blades such as the wakizashi and tanto, forming a pair called the daishō, which represented the samurai’s social position and private identity.
The crafting of samurai swords is surely an artwork variety in alone, deeply rooted in tradition and spiritual self-discipline. Swordsmiths, generally known as tosho, adopted demanding rituals during the forging method. The steel utilised, often known as tamahagane, was manufactured from iron sand and punctiliously refined through repeated heating and folding. This folding procedure eliminated impurities and developed the unique layered pattern observed on several genuine blades. The forging of samurai swords also concerned a complex heat-treatment process that combined hard and tender metal, leading to a blade that was the two sharp and versatile. This equilibrium of energy and resilience has become the motives samurai swords are still admired these days.

The design of samurai swords also reflects a perfect mixture of engineering and aesthetics. The tackle, or tsuka, is thoroughly wrapped in silk or cotton for grip and luxury. The guard, or tsuba, is usually intricately decorated with artistic motifs, in some cases depicting mother nature, mythology, or household crests. Even the scabbard, or saya, is crafted with precision to guard the blade while keeping class. Each individual part of samurai swords is made with each functionality and wonder in mind, earning them Extraordinary examples of regular craftsmanship.
